Output b10e0532f83c279f6c915c5b2c63c9bb96cb715eead040d665ee652d58cc8536:2

value
23322569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49b51546eeb7667c940e6f5f819ce6ee13630489 OP_EQUAL
address
MEctVJt7wkueyR2BVZw9HczaSgEQjuyDft
transaction
b10e0532f83c279f6c915c5b2c63c9bb96cb715eead040d665ee652d58cc8536
spent
true